About our Team

Our global team supports products that educate electronic health records that introduce students to digital charting and prepare them to document care in today's modern clinical environment. We have a very stable product that we've worked to get to and strive to maintain. Our team values trust, respect, collaboration, agility, and quality.

About the Role

In this role, you will define and lead AI and data science strategy across machine learning, NLP, search, and generative AI to deliver impactful, scalable solutions. You will guide teams through the full lifecycle of AI systems, from experimentation to production, while aligning work to product goals and customer needs. You will also influence senior stakeholders, shape roadmaps, and drive measurable outcomes across the organization.

Responsibilities

  • Set AI and data science strategy across ML, NLP, search, recommendation, experimentation, and generative AI, aligning work to product goals, customer needs, and business priorities.
  • Lead and develop high-performing teams by coaching talent, setting priorities, fostering scientific rigor, and building an inclusive, collaborative culture.
  • Deliver advanced AI and knowledge-discovery systems across the full lifecycle, from experimentation through production, including LLMs, RAG, search, and domain-enriched AI solutions.
  • Drive evaluation and AI quality by establishing robust frameworks, metrics, experimentation practices, and responsible AI standards.
  • Influence across product, technology, and business by partnering with cross-functional leaders, shaping roadmaps, translating technical insights, and aligning teams on customer and business impact.

Requirements

  • Significant experience in data science, AI/ML, NLP, information retrieval, statistics, or a related quantitative field, or equivalent practical experience.
  • Strong technical expertise across modern data science methods, including machine learning, experimentation, deep learning, generative AI, and production AI systems.
  • Hands-on experience delivering AI-powered products, including LLMs, RAG, semantic search, embeddings, agentic workflows, and knowledge-driven systems.
  • Proven success leading and developing technical teams in complex product, platform, or research environments.
  • Experience working with large, complex datasets and building scalable, maintainable, production-ready AI/ML systems.
  • Strong people leadership, prioritization, communication, and stakeholder management skills, with the ability to turn ambiguity into clear strategy and measurable outcomes.
